Materialize
FrameworksMaterialize is a modern CSS framework that provides a responsive grid system, pre-built components, and a collection of utility classes to help developers build beautiful and performant websites quickly. It is inspired by Google's Material Design principles, offering a clean and intuitive user interface.
Our Analysis
Angular is significantly more popular than Materialize in our dataset, appearing on 1881 websites compared to 41. 1 website uses both technologies together (0% overlap). Both are in the Frameworks category, making them direct alternatives.
